How much do mobile remote rn insurance j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for mobile remote rn insurance in Chattanooga, TN is $68.02,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$60.87 and $76.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Mobile Remote Rn Insurance vs Mobile Remote Lpn Insurance?

AspectMobile Remote Rn InsuranceMobile Remote Lpn Insurance
CredentialsRegistered Nurse (RN) licenseL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license
Work EnvironmentRemote, patient assessments, insurance documentationRemote, basic patient support, insurance processing
Industry UsageCommonly used in insurance and healthcare sectorsUsed in similar sectors but with LPN-specific roles

Mobile Remote Rn Insurance and Mobile Remote Lpn Insurance roles both involve remote work within the healthcare insurance industry. RNs typically handle more complex patient assessments and documentation, requiring RN licensure, while LPNs focus on basic support tasks. Both roles are essential in insurance processing and patient communication, but RNs generally have more advanced responsibilities.
